The Identity Card Distribution Unit under Devaswom Board Vigilance is the one department that works silently in every pilgrimage season. The unit is always busy issuing id cards this year as well. 7625 identity cards have been issued so far during this pilgrimage season. This ranges from government employees to devaswom employees, vendors, their workers, daily-wage workers, NGOs like Sabarimala Ayyappa Seva Samajam, Akhila Bharatiya Ayyappa Seva Sangham, journalists, Sabarimala Sanitation Society, temporary security guards, and dolly carriers. The entire identity cards of Sannidhanam and Pampa are issued from the identity card section of the Sannidhanam Festival Control Office. The cards were issued after Devaswom Vigilance SP signs it. The card is valid up to the end of this year's pilgrimage season.
The highest number of cards was issued to the daily wage-earners - 2333. The card was issued to 1858 vendors this time and 1052 government officials have also been issued with the id cards from the office. Sabarimala Sanitation Society-912, NGO-885, Dolly-84, Devaswom employees -73 and Temporary Security Guards-68, such as the number of cards issued so far this year. More than 15,000 cards are expected to be issued this season. Last time it was 13000.
From this time onwards, the identity of each employee's card can be identified by looking at the different colour tags. The government employee's card tag is blue. Orange is the colour for daily wagers. The color of the tag for vendors is green, sanitation-society workers are black, journalists-white and NGO-red. Until last time, everyone had the same colour tag.
Under Vigilance SI Manu Menon, 11 employees are in charge of card issuance from 9 am to 11 pm. The card will be issued to the government employees after they submit the application and photo in the letterhead. NGOs and others need a police clearance certificate, id card, Aadhaar number, and photo.
